gpt4 book ai didi

java - 如何更新 Derby 数据库的版本

转载 作者:搜寻专家 更新时间:2023-10-30 23:45:45 24 4
gpt4 key购买 nike

当尝试创建一个包含 boolean 字段的表时,我遇到了一个 Derby 错误,提示我将数据库版本从 10.3 更新到 10.7。我发现这个问题显然包含解决方案:

Tables for entities with boolean fields not created

但我在 syscs_util 数据库中看不到 syscs_get_database_property 过程。我快速浏览了 Derby 文档,但没有在其中找到任何对“更新”或“版本”的引用。

我不能/不想重命名/丢失数据库只是为了更新数据库,就像其他线程建议解决问题一样;另外,我不使用 JPA 来创建模式。有什么方法可以实际更新数据库(无论哪种方式)?我在 NetBeans 中使用最新的 Java SE 8 Java DB/Derby JAR,它被定义为我的桌面应用程序中使用的库,只是从 Java SE 7 更改过来的。

TIA

最佳答案

要将您的数据库升级到更新版本,请按照此处的文档操作:http://db.apache.org/derby/docs/10.11/devguide/cdevupgrades.html

关于java - 如何更新 Derby 数据库的版本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28866044/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com